During the almost hour-long conversation, drawing from their own painful experiences, each person present presented proposals to the Pope so that the Church’s response to such dramatic cases would be more effective.
The Pope listened with attention and kindness, assuring them of his closeness and that of the entire ecclesial community. The Holy Father also assured them of his commitment to ensure that the proposals presented would form the basis for further actions, so that the Church could truly be a safe and spiritually healthy place where wounds suffered would find comfort and healing.
The Press Office reported that the victims felt that the Pope shared their pain.
As previously reported by the Holy See Press Office, the meeting between the Pope and victims of sexual abuse by clergy was organized by the Church in Spain.
